Skip to main content

PetaScope: An Open-Source Implementation of the OGC WCS Geo Service Standards Suite

  • Conference paper
Scientific and Statistical Database Management (SSDBM 2010)

Part of the book series: Lecture Notes in Computer Science ((LNISA,volume 6187))

Abstract

A growing number of scientific data archives set up Web interfaces for researchers and sometimes for the general public. While these services often deploy sophisticated search facilities, these are constrained to metadata level where conventional SQL/XML technology can be leveraged; no comparable retrieval support is available on original observation or simulation data.

For raster data in the earth sciences, this is overcome by the 2008 Open GeoSpatial Consortium (OGC) Web Coverage Processing Service (WCPS) standard. It defines a retrieval language on multi-dimensional raster data for ad-hoc navigation, extraction, aggregation, and analysis. WCPS is part of the Web Coverage Service (WCS) suite which additionally contains a simple retrieval service and a upload and update service for raster data.

In this contribution we present PetaScope, an open-source implementation of the complete WCS suite. Most of the suite’s functionality is available already, and a first code version has been released. An online showcase is being built, and the system will soon undergo real-life evaluation on mass data. After briefly introducing the WCPS language concept we discuss the architecture of the service stack based on examples publicly available on the demo website.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Baumann, P. (ed.): Web Coverage Processing Service (WCPS) Implementation Specification. Number 08-068. OGC, 1.0.0 edn. (2008)

    Google Scholar 

  2. Baumann, P.: The ogc web coverage processing service (wcps) standard. Geoinformatica (2009)

    Google Scholar 

  3. Baumann, P.: A database array algebra for spatio-temporal data and beyond. In: Tsur, S. (ed.) NGITS 1999. LNCS, vol. 1649, pp. 76–93. Springer, Heidelberg (1999)

    Chapter  Google Scholar 

  4. Calori, L., Gheller, C., Rossi, E., Amati, G.: Astrotool: Data management and visualisation in astrophysics. In: IST 2002, November 4 - 6 (2002)

    Google Scholar 

  5. Cappelaere, P.: Nasa wcps for ground-space interoperability, http://www.geobliki.com/2009/08/11/nasa-wcps-for-ground-space-interoperability (seen 22-01-2010)

  6. Deegree. Deegree-free software for spatial data infrastructures (2009), http://www.deegree.org/ (seen 22-01-2010)

  7. Dehmel, A.: A Compression Engine for Multidimensional Array Database Systems. Phd thesis, TU Muenchen (2001)

    Google Scholar 

  8. Furtado, P.: Storage Management of Multidimensional Arrays in Database Management Systems. Phd thesis, TU Muenchen (1999)

    Google Scholar 

  9. Gutierrez, A.G., Baumann, P.: Modeling fundamental geo-raster operations with array algebra. In: IEEE International Workshop in Spatial and Spatio-Temporal Data Mining, pp. 607–612 (2007)

    Google Scholar 

  10. Hahn, K., Reiner, B.: Intra-query parallelism for multidimensional array data. In: 28th International Conference on Very Large Data Bases, VLDB 2002 August 20 (2002)

    Google Scholar 

  11. Jucovschi, C.: Precompiling Queries in a Raster Database System. Bachelor thesis, Jacobs University Bremen (2008)

    Google Scholar 

  12. Kleese, K., Baumann, P.: Intelligent support for high i/o requirements of leading edge scientific codes on high-end computing systems - the estedi project. In: Proc. Sixth European SGI/Cray MPP Workshop, September 7-8 (2000)

    Google Scholar 

  13. n.n. Geographic Information - Coverage Geometry and Functions. Number 19123:2005. ISO (2005)

    Google Scholar 

  14. n.n. rasdaman query language guide, 8.1 edn. (2009)

    Google Scholar 

  15. OGC. Wcs. (2010), http://www.opengeospatial.org/standards/wcs (seen 22-01-2010)

  16. Parr, T.J., Parr, T.J., Quong, R.W.: Antlr: A predicated-ll(k) parser generator (1995)

    Google Scholar 

  17. Buneman, P.: The Fast Fourier Transform as a Database Query. Technical Report MS-CIS-93-37, University of Pennsylvania (1993)

    Google Scholar 

  18. Pisarev, A., Poustelnikova, E., Samsonova, M., Baumann, P.: Mooshka: a system for the management of multidimensional gene expression data in situ. Information Systems 28, 269–285 (2003)

    Article  MATH  Google Scholar 

  19. Ritsch, R.: Optimization and Evaluation of Array Queries in Database Management Systems. Phd thesis, TU Muenchen (1999)

    Google Scholar 

  20. Stancu-Mara, S.: Using Graphic Cards for Accelerating Raster Database Query Processing. Bachelor thesis, Jacobs University Bremen (2008)

    Google Scholar 

  21. THREDDS. Thematic realtime environmental distributed data services (2009), http://www.unidata.ucar.edu/projects/THREDDS/ (seen 22-01-2010)

  22. Whiteside, A. (ed.): Web Coverage Service (WCS) Transaction Operation Extension. Number 07-068r4. OGC (2008)

    Google Scholar 

  23. Whiteside, A., Evans, J. (eds.): Web Coverage Service (WCS) Implementation Specification, Number 07-067r5. OGC, 1.1.2 edn. (2008)

    Google Scholar 

  24. Widmann, N.: Efficient Operation Execution on Multidimensional Array Data. Phd thesis, TU Muenchen (2000)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2010 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Aiordăchioaie, A., Baumann, P. (2010). PetaScope: An Open-Source Implementation of the OGC WCS Geo Service Standards Suite. In: Gertz, M., Ludäscher, B. (eds) Scientific and Statistical Database Management. SSDBM 2010. Lecture Notes in Computer Science, vol 6187.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-13818-8_13

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-13818-8_13

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-13817-1

  • Online ISBN: 978-3-642-13818-8

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ics